Meaning of FLEUR-DE-LIS in English

noun the iris. ·see flower-de-luce.

2. fleur-de-lis ·noun a conventional flower suggested by the iris, and having a form which fits it for the terminal decoration of a scepter, the ornaments of a crown, ·etc. it is also a heraldic bearing, and is identified with the royal arms and adornments of france.

Webster English vocab.      Английский словарь Webster.